Yes you can do that by simply tuning ILS frequency and course and fly everything selected HDG select, Speed select, manual thrust and fly raw data ILS, the VLS is V approach without auto thrust. It is as simple as that provided you have the skill. Raw data is easier in Airbus since it holds it's flight path. If you can't do it in the bus you won't be doing it in Boeing either. Approach mode is a flight director mode you need to know how to programme it. Next if you don't have the approach in data base how will it be in the FMGS? I have my doubts if you are type rated.
